库存记录

查询产品库存记录

URLhttp://test.birdsystem.com/client/Container-Product-Transaction
接口功能查询产品库存记录
支持格式JSON开发人员
请求方式GET发布时间

查询参数

参数名注释示例

product_id

产品ID

product_id=1
sort排序sort=[{"property":"update_time","direction":"DESC"}]
limit获取多少条记录limit=50

请求示例

http://test.birdsystem.com/client/Container-Product-Transaction?product_id=2941864&sort=[{"property":"update_time","direction":"DESC"}]

返回示例

{
    "total": 7,
    "data": [
        {
            "total": null,
            "quantity_left": null,
            "id": 54386927,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"10",
            "consignment_id": null,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": 1745,
            "note": null,
            "update_time": "2020-11-26 11:37:06",
            "type": "ADJUSTM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386819,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"-1",
            "consignment_id": 2005290360000029,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": null,
            "note": null,
            "update_time": "2020-05-29 17:48:52",
            "type": "CONSIGNM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386820,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"-1",
            "consignment_id": 2005290360000030,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": null,
            "note": null,
            "update_time": "2020-05-29 17:48:52",
            "type": "CONSIGNM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386821,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"-1",
            "consignment_id": 2005290360000031,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": null,
            "note": null,
            "update_time": "2020-05-29 17:48:52",
            "type": "CONSIGNM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386822,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"-1",
            "consignment_id": 2005290360000032,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": null,
            "note": null,
            "update_time": "2020-05-29 17:48:52",
            "type": "CONSIGNM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386823,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"-1",
            "consignment_id": 2005290360000033,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": null,
            "note": null,
            "update_time": "2020-05-29 17:48:52",
            "type": "CONSIGNMENT",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        },
        {
            "total": null,
            "quantity_left": null,
            "id": 54386804,
            "container_id": 1935355,
            "product_id": 2941864,
            "quantity": "100",
            "consignment_id": null,
            "warehouse_dispatch_id": null,
            "client_dispatch_id": null,
            "warehouse_transfer_id": null,
            "additional_service_id": null,
            "company_user_id": 1834,
            "note": null,
            "update_time": "2020-05-29 15:31:45",
            "type": "MOVE_STOCK",
            "primary_keys": [
                "id"
            ],
            "container-reference": "101999"
        }
    ],
    "success": true,
    "moduleName": "client"
}

返回说明

列名注释类型
id库存记录列表IDINT(10)
container_id货架上的容器IDINT(10)
product_id产品IDINT(10)
quantity数量INT(10)
consignment_id订单IDBIGINT(16)
client_dispatch_id发货单IDINT(10)
update_time更新时间TIMESTAMP
type类型'ADJUSTMENT'(调整),'CONSIGNMENT'(订单),'WAREHOUSE_DISPATCH'(仓库发货),"INVENTORY_PROFIT(盘盈)","INVENTORY_LOSS(盘亏,数量必须为负数)","SLOW_PRODUCT_ADJUSTMENT(滞销库存调整)","CORRECTION(数据修复)","ADDITIONAL_SERVICE_INVENTORY_OUT(增值服务—下架)","WAREHOUSE_TRANSFER(仓库调拨)","WAREHOUSE_CHECE(仓库查验)","CLIENT_DISPATCH_TRANSFER(客户发货)","CLIENT_DISPATCH(客户发货单直接上架)","RETURN(退货)",“MOVE_STOCK(移库存)”
container-reference容器IDINT(10)

添加产品库存

URLhttps://test.birdsystem.com/admin/Container-Product-Transaction/
接口功能添加产品库存
支持格式JSON开发人员
请求方式POST发布日期
参数说明是否必填类型
container-reference容器referenceYINT(10)
product_id产品IDYINT(10)
quantity数量YINT(10)
client_id客户IDNINT(10)
type种类Y'ADJUSTMENT'(调整),'CONSIGNMENT'(订单),'WAREHOUSE_DISPATCH'(仓库发货),"INVENTORY_PROFIT(盘盈)","INVENTORY_LOSS(盘亏,数量必须为负数)","SLOW_PRODUCT_ADJUSTMENT(滞销库存调整)","CORRECTION(数据修复)","ADDITIONAL_SERVICE_INVENTORY_OUT(增值服务—下架)","WAREHOUSE_TRANSFER(仓库调拨)","WAREHOUSE_CHECE(仓库查验)","CLIENT_DISPATCH_TRANSFER(客户发货)","CLIENT_DISPATCH(客户发货单直接上架)","RETURN(退货)",“MOVE_STOCK(移库存)”
note备注NVARCHAR
jump_over_client_company_check跳过客户站点检查N0/1(1表示跳过客户站点检查)

返回示例

{
    "data": {
        "total": null,
        "quantity_left": null,
        "id": 54386955,
        "container_id": 5502451,
        "product_id": 2990372,
        "quantity": "1",
        "consignment_id": null,
        "warehouse_dispatch_id": null,
        "client_dispatch_id": null,
        "warehouse_transfer_id": null,
        "additional_service_id": null,
        "company_user_id": 1745,
        "note": null,
        "update_time": "2020-12-02 15:07:46",
        "type": "ADJUSTMENT",
        "primary_keys": [
            "id"
        ]
    },
    "success": true,
    "moduleName": "admin"
}

返回说明

字段说明
id系统库存记录ID
container_id货架上的容器ID
quantity添加数量
product_id产品ID
company_user_id用户ID
update_time最后更新时间
type种类